Ingredients

2 2/3 cups all-purpose flour (spooned and leveled) 

2 teaspoons baking soda 

1/2 teaspoon fine salt 

2 sticks unsalted butter, room temperature 

2/3 cup granulated sugar 

1 cup packed light-brown sugar 

2 large eggs 

1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ract 

1 cup semisweet chocolate chips 

1 cup dried tart cherries 

Preparation

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Whisk together flour, baking soda, and salt.

In a large bowl, using a mixer, beat butter and both sugars on high until pale and fluffy, 3 minutes. Beat in eggs and vanilla. Reduce speed to low, add flour mixture, and beat until combined. Stir in chocolate chips and cherries.

Press mixture into a 9-by-13-inch metal baking pan.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out with a few moist crumbs attached, 28 to 30 minutes. Let cool completely in pan on a wire rack.
